The FINANCIAL — The International School for Sustainable Eco-Tourism (ISSE) recognized legacy carrier Philippine Airlines for its significant contribution to the development and promotion of eco-tourism and sustainable tourism practices which help the lives of the people in various communities.
The 2017 Subic Eco-Tourism Festival Award was received by PAL SAVP Passenger Sales Philippines Harry Inoferio – for PAL President and COO Jaime J. Bautista – at the Subic Bay Exhibition and Convention Center, Subic Freeport Zone, according to PAL.
Dr. Mina Gabor, Chairman and President for Sustainable Ecotourism and Robert Lim Joseph-Vice Chairman for Sustainable Ecotourism presented the award to PAL.
